Address

Nhe6w9EJAGwoN8QRUynTfUvJs5hL2Cg3kR

0 XNA

Confirmed
Total Received1330.94262588 XNA
Total Sent1330.94262588 XNA
Final Balance0 XNA
No. Transactions2

Transactions

Nhe6w9EJAGwoN8QRUynTfUvJs5hL2Cg3kR1330.94262588 XNA
 
 
Nhe6w9EJAGwoN8QRUynTfUvJs5hL2Cg3kR1330.94262588 XNA